    When my daughter was two years old, I sensed that her speech wasn't where it should be. She…read morequalified for a specialized program through Broward County Schools starting at age three, and while she made progress, she was still behind her peers, particularly in articulation and certain language elements. A friend recommended Bridge Theory, so I reached out at the end of May 2024, and we began therapy in June 2024. Samantha paired us with Ms. Rebecca, who truly is an angel in disguise. To say my daughter's progress was remarkable is an understatement. Every week, we saw noticeable improvements--whether it was her self-correcting when asked to repeat a word or taking the time to think before speaking. As a mother in education, I could clearly see the difference between group therapy at school and one-on-one therapy. In a group setting, they were working on IEP goals, but with several kids in the group, the time spent walking between locations and occasional canceled sessions, the progress was limited. My daughter didn't have many major errors, but she was definitely behind, and in just seven and a half months, she graduated! The level of attention to detail, the thoughtful explanations, and the strong rapport Ms. Rebecca built with my daughter made all the difference. She also took the time to listen to my concerns as a parent and would incorporate additional strategies to address what I was seeing. This personalized approach is something you can't get in group therapy. Ms. Rebecca is truly an angel--my daughter loved coming to her speech lessons and would run into her arms for a hug. They formed a beautiful bond that made each session something to look forward to. Although lessons have ended, our gratitude for Ms. Rebecca and Samantha will last a lifetime. It has been a blessing to be part of the Bridge family, and we are so thankful for the pivotal role they've played in our lives. Thank you, Bridge, Ms. Rebecca, and Samantha, for helping us on the path to success!
